Télécharger la liste

Description du projet

OpenCFLite is a portable version of Apple's open
source CoreFoundation framework.

Système requise

System requirement is not defined
Information regarding Project Releases and Project Resources. Note that the information here is a quote from Freecode.com page, and the downloads themselves may not be hosted on OSDN.

2011-09-08 07:27 Retour à la liste release
476.19.0

Ce communiqué traite d'un bug dans CFSetApplyFunction qui auraient abouti à l'accès et la modification de la mémoire libérée. Il enlève le soutien, sous Linux, en utilisant la méthode d'introspection malloc_usable_size lors de l'instanciation des instances d'exécution. Il ajoute le support pour effectuer des contrôles de cohérence de débogage sous Linux sur la mémoire libérée par l'allocateur système. Il met à niveau le AssertMacros.h partir CarbonHeaders-8A428 à celle du CarbonHeaders-18.1. Il ajoute le support ARM. Il aborde un certain nombre d'avertissements et d'erreurs du compilateur. Symbole de la visibilité limitée et la fonction basés sur les définitions du préprocesseur. Un correctif pour la détection de la bibliothèque de l'UUID.
This release addresses a bug in CFSetApplyFunction that could have resulted in it accessing and modifying deallocated memory. It removes support, in Linux, for using the malloc_usable_size introspection method when instantiating runtime instances. It adds support for performing debug consistency checks in Linux on memory deallocated by the system allocator. It upgrades the AssertMacros.h from CarbonHeaders-8A428 to that from CarbonHeaders-18.1. It adds ARM support. It addresses a number of compiler warnings and errors. Limited symbol and function visibility based on preprocessor definitions. A fix for UUID library detection.

Project Resources